Profile

Operating within the UK and European Operations function, this senior contract role is responsible for directing the design and development of processes, systems, instruments and equipment from laboratory through to manufacturing environments.

The position will oversee the identification, deployment and governance of technology solutions supporting product development and operational processes, whilst leading strategic vendor interactions and technology initiatives. Responsibilities include equipment acquisition and validation, process development and validation activities, and support of pilot plant and R&D operational environments. The role will have significant exposure to the development, implementation and operation of production and R&D facilities within regulated industrial and life sciences environments. Working across multiple concurrent projects and stakeholder groups, the successful candidate will collaborate closely with business leaders, end users, vendors, service providers and cross‑functional teams to deliver technology solutions aligned with operational strategy and business objectives.

Whilst the role has no direct reports, it will involve leadership of cross‑functional project teams and oversight of external contractors. The position requires a highly organised, adaptable and hands‑on approach within a fast‑paced environment.
